In StarCraft 2, one of the tougher challenges is to beat the computer opponent on Insane level (the hardest setting). There are even achievements to be got when you are able to do so (beating the Insane computer 10 times is one). The following are three basic ways to defeat the computer AI opponent on Insane level setting:

1) Technique one is to find a pattern that the AI uses, and take advantage of it. An example is that the AI computer opponent will always pull their troops back to their base if their base is under attack, even if those superior troops are in your base.
2) Technique two is to keeping the computer busy attacking you with workers instead of building troops at the beginning of the game.
3) Technique three is to surround and starve their one base until they run out of minerals.
